This weekend the second collection is for the Catholic Trust for England & Wales, which supplies the Bishops of England and Wales with the revenue necessary for the central administration of the Church.


Next weekend will be our monthly Addiscombe Catholic Aid collection. Funds raised will go to Maryhill, the school run by the Daughters of Mary & Joseph in Uganda.
